Drug Class
Calcium supplement, Vitamin D supplement, Mineral supplement
Uses & Indications
Used to prevent or treat calcium and vitamin D deficiency, support bone health, and may aid in the prevention of osteoporosis. Magnesium supports various biochemical reactions in the body, including muscle and nerve function.
Storage Requirements
Store at room temperature (20-25°C or 68-77°F) in a dry place, away from direct sunlight and moisture.

Dosage Information
Adult Dose
1-2 tablets daily, preferably taken with food to enhance absorption
Pediatric Dose
Not typically recommended for children under 12 years; consult a healthcare provider for pediatric dosing
Side Effects
Common side effects may include gastrointestinal upset, constipation, diarrhea, and nausea. Rarely, may cause hypercalcemia or hypermagnesemia.
Contraindications & Precautions
Hypersensitivity to any component, hypercalcemia, severe renal impairment, and certain types of kidney stones (calcium-based).
Important Warnings
Consult a healthcare provider before use if pregnant, nursing, have a history of kidney stones, or are taking other medications that may interact. Excessive intake may lead to serious health issues.
